Abstract
We consider four-dimensional spacetimes (M, g) which obey the Einstein equations G = T and admit a global spacelike G1 =Risometry group. By means of dimensional reduction and local analysis on the reduced (2 + 1) spacetime, we obtain a sufficient condition on T which guarantees that (M, g) cannot contain apparent horizons. Given any (3 + 1) spacetime with spacelike translational isometry, the no-horizon condition can be readily tested without the need for dimensional reduction. This provides thus a useful and encompassing apparent horizon test for G1-symmetric spacetimes. We argue that this adds further evidence towards the validity of the hoop conjecture and signals possible (albeit arguably unlikely) violations of strong cosmic censorship.
